Study of the quasi-two-body decays Bs0→ψ(3770)(ψ(3686))π+π with perturbative QCD approach

Description

In this note, we study the contributions from the S-wave resonances, f0(980) and f0(1500), to the Bs0→ψ(3770)π+π decay by introducing the S-wave ππ distribution amplitudes within the framework of perturbative QCD approach. Both the resonant and the non-resonant contributions are contained in the scalar form factor in the S-wave distribution amplitude ΦππS. Since the vector charmonium meson ψ(3770) is a S–D wave mixed state, we calculate the branching ratios of S-wave and D-wave, respectively, and the results indicate that f0(980) is the main contribution of the considered decay, and the branching ratio of the ψ(2S) mode is in good agreement with the experimental data. We also take the S–D mixed effect into the Bs0→ψ(3686)π+π decay. Our calculations show that the branching ratio of Bs0→ψ(3770)(ψ(3686))π+π can be at the order of 105, which can be tested by the running LHCb experiments.
